在数字化时代,前端开发变得越来越重要。Semantic UI是一个非常受欢迎的前端框架,它不仅提供了丰富的UI组件,还强调了语义化的设计理念。今天,我们就来一起探索如何从零开始掌握Semantic UI,结合semcore和ui库,让你的前端项目更加高效和美观。
一、Semantic UI基础
首先,我们需要了解Semantic UI的基本概念。Semantic UI通过类名来定义样式,这使得HTML代码更加直观易懂。安装Semantic UI也很简单,只需要引入相应的CSS和JS文件即可。例如:
```html
<script src="https://cdn.jsdelivr.net/npm/semantic-ui@2.4.2/dist/semantic.min.js"></script>
```
二、深入学习Semantic UI组件
接下来,我们进入Semantic UI的核心部分——组件。Semantic UI提供了诸如按钮、卡片、表单等丰富的UI组件。这些组件不仅功能强大,而且使用起来非常方便。例如,创建一个简单的按钮:
```html
```
三、结合semcore和ui库
为了进一步提升开发效率,我们可以结合使用Semantic UI与semcore和ui库。semcore是一个基于React的UI库,而ui库则提供了更多的实用工具。这两者的结合可以让我们更轻松地构建复杂的前端界面。
四、实战案例
最后,我们通过一个实际案例来巩固所学知识。假设我们需要创建一个用户登录页面,使用Semantic UI的表单组件,结合semcore的布局组件,可以快速实现这一目标。例如:
```jsx
import React from 'react';
import { Form, Input } from 'semantic-ui-react';
import { Layout } from '@alifd/semcore';
const { Content } = Layout;
function LoginPage() {
return (
);
}
export default LoginPage;
```
通过以上步骤,相信你已经对Semantic UI有了初步的认识,并且能够结合semcore和ui库进行实际开发。希望这篇指南对你有所帮助!🚀